The mission to promote creative activities which harminize traditional forms of artistic expression and modern reflections to breathe fresh life into diverse cultural heritage unique to various ethnic populations in Asia, so traditions are valued not only for its antiquity but, no less meaningfully, its services to the contempories as an infinite.

What are CENTER FOR CULTURAL & CREATIVE EXCHANGE A NJ NONPROFT CORPORATION's revenue and expenses?
In 2024, CENTER FOR CULTURAL & CREATIVE EXCHANGE A NJ NONPROFT CORPORATION reported $25k in total revenue and $32k in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
